A series of 47 patients with carpal tunnel syndrome was systematically examined for the presence of Tinel's sign, and the results were compared to those in a group of patients with normal hands. In both groups Tinel's sign occurred, and there was no statistically significant difference in its frequency. Therefore it is concluded that Tinel's sign is of no diagnostic value.
